Your Committee on Legislative Management, to which was referred H.C.R. No. 107, H.D. 1, entitled:
"HOUSE CONCURRENT RESOLUTION REQUESTING THE AUDITOR TO CONDUCT A FINANCIAL, PROGRAM, AND MANAGEMENT AUDIT OF THE DEPARTMENT OF EDUCATION'S HAWAIIAN STUDIES PROGRAM,"
begs leave to report as follows:
The purpose of this concurrent resolution is to request the Auditor to conduct a financial, program, and management audit of the Department of Education's (DOE) Hawaiian studies programs. The financial audit is intended to clarify inconsistencies in budgeting and spending, and the program and management audit would identify areas of concern regarding program delivery or implementation.
DOE, the Office of Hawaiian Affairs, Ka Lei Papahi o Kakuhihewa, and numerous concerned individuals testified in support of this concurrent resolution.
As affirmed by the record of votes of the members of your Committee on Legislative Management that is attached to this report, your Committee concurs with the intent and purpose of H.C.R. No. 107, H.D. 1, and recommends its adoption.
